Toho Holdings (8129) Q3 2025 earnings summary
Event summary combining transcript, slides, and related documents.
Q3 2025 earnings summary
10 Feb, 2026Executive summary
Achieved record-high revenue and profit for the first nine months of FY2/25, driven by strong performance in cinema, animation, and theatrical segments.
Operating revenue for the nine months ended November 30, 2024, rose 15.3% year-on-year to ¥234,169 million, with operating profit up 26.9% to ¥52,801 million and profit attributable to owners of parent up 20.2% to ¥34,141 million.
Major hit films and successful animation titles significantly contributed to growth.
Strategic investments and M&A activity, including the acquisition of GKIDS, INC. and Science SARU Inc., expanded international presence and content portfolio.
Growth was achieved despite a decrease in movie theater attendance and ongoing economic uncertainty.
Financial highlights
Operating revenue rose 15.3% year-over-year to ¥234,169 million for Q3 FY2/25.
Operating profit increased 26.9% to ¥52,801 million; ordinary profit up 16.7% to ¥51,552 million.
Profit attributable to owners of parent grew 20.2% to ¥34,141 million.
Gross profit increased from ¥91,276 million to ¥109,243 million year-on-year.
Basic earnings per share rose to ¥200.38 from ¥162.68 year-on-year.
Outlook and guidance
FY2/25 full-year forecast: operating revenue ¥297,000 million, operating profit ¥62,000 million, profit attributable to owners of parent ¥40,000 million.
No revision to previously announced business or dividend forecasts.
Annual dividend forecast of ¥70 per share, with a payout ratio of 30% or more.
